原文:js處理時間時區問題

問題背景:服務器時間是東八區時間,頁面會在全世界各地,頁面 JS 功能需要對比服務器時間和用戶本地時間,為兼容世界各地時間,需要將用戶本地時間轉換為東八區時間 一 基本概念 格林威治時間 格林威治子午線上的地方時,或零時區 中時區 的區時叫做格林威治時間,也叫世界時。比如我們中國是東八區,北京時間是 GMT : 獲得本地與格林威治時間的時差:new Date .getTimezoneOffset ...

2019-03-13 19:22 1 7962 推薦指數:

查看詳情

js 處理 時區時間問題

假如我們在Vue項目中遇到了需要保證有些東西需要在所有打開頁面地區的十點之后才可以展示出來 那么我們可以 使用一個js時間庫 moment.js 這里是文檔 http://momentjs.cn/docs/#/displaying/as-object ...

Mon Mar 29 18:09:00 CST 2021 0 240
用datetime模塊處理轉換時區時間問題,而不是time模塊

要點: 1.不要用time模塊在不同時區間轉換 2.如果要在不同時區之間執行可靠的轉換,可以用內置的datetime模塊和開發者社區提供的pytz模塊搭配起來使用 3.開發者總是應該先把時間轉換成UTC格式的時間,然后再進行其他操作,最后再轉換為本地時間 time模塊 time.time ...

Wed Jan 15 23:54:00 CST 2020 0 923
django時間時區問題

在用django1.8版本做項目的時候遇到時間的存儲與讀取不一致的問題,網上找了很多帖子,但都沒有講明白。本文將在項目中遇到的問題及如何解決的盡可能詳細的記錄下來,當然本文參考了網上大量相關文章。 在django1.4以后,存在兩個概念:naive time 與 active time。簡單點講 ...

Fri Aug 05 08:26:00 CST 2016 0 7454
Django時間時區問題

在django1.4以后,存在兩個概念 naive time 與 active time。 簡單點講,naive time就是不帶時區時間,Active time就是帶時區時間。 舉例來說,使用datetime.datetime.utcnow ...

Wed Feb 20 03:37:00 CST 2019 0 794
django時間時區問題

在用django1.8版本做項目的時候遇到時間的存儲與讀取不一致的問題,網上找了很多帖子,但都沒有講明白。本文將在項目中遇到的問題及如何解決的盡可能詳細的記錄下來,當然本文參考了網上大量相關文章。 在django1.4以后,存在兩個概念:naive time 與 active time。簡單點講 ...

Tue Jun 23 04:08:00 CST 2020 0 948
js Date 時間時區問題總結

js 的Date 時間戳並沒有時區的概念 在任何時區 打印new Date(1) 顯示的都是相對時間 如下: var t = new Date(1); t // Thu Jan 01 1970 08:00:00 GMT+0800 (中國標准時間) //將電腦的時區 改為 ...

Tue Nov 19 19:40:00 CST 2019 0 1422
JS一個根據時區輸出時區時間的函數

做項目遇到的坑爹問題,需要根據時區獲取時區中軸線的時間。為此搜了好久網上都沒什么JS的代碼描述到這一方面,最后自己翻了下高中地理才寫了個函數出來。 此圖可以看出來,全球分為了0時區,東西1-11區,第12時區。下面就是我寫的JS的根據時區輸出時間的函數: 這里用到 ...

Sat May 23 15:48:00 CST 2015 0 8888
JS 根據時區獲取時間

// 北京是getZoneTime(8),紐約是getZoneTime(-5),班加羅爾是getZoneTime(5.5). 偏移值是本時區相對於格林尼治所在時區時區差值 function getZoneTime(offset) { // 取本地時間 var ...

Tue Jun 23 22:13:00 CST 2020 0 2810
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M